In this capacity, the successful candidate will be responsible for the following:

  • Must perform all testing/inspections in a timely manner and adhere to Gannett Flemings Quality Management Protocols (QMP)
  • Complete daily inspection reports on a daily basis
  • Represent the client and Gannett Fleming interests in a professional manner and appearance
  • Be onsite during contractor work activities
  • Report and take directions from the Resident Engineer
Education | Experience:

What you'll bring to our firm:

  • BS - Civil Engineering or Structural Engineering, preferred
  • ICC/NICET II, III, or IV Highway Construction
  • 4-10 years bridge, tunnel, and/or aeronautical construction inspection experience
  • OSHA 30-hr
  • Divers license and ability to obtain high SWAC clearance, SIDA card and/or Custom ID.
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ills and presentation skills
  • In addition to night and weekend shift work, ability to stay late or come in early as needed.

What we prefer you bring:

  • ACI Concrete Special Inspector, Work Zone Safety certifications desired

Compensation:

The salary range for this role is $55,000 - $124,000. Salary is dependent upon experience and geographic location.
